    RIB RUB RECIPE
    2 tablespoons of brown sugar
    1 tablespoon of seasoned salt
    1 tablespoon of cinnamon
    1 tablespoon of ginger
    1/2 teaspoon of cayenne pepper (add more or less depending on how hot you like it)
    This is enough for 1 rack of ribs
